What is a dispatch associate?

Dispatch Associates are professionals responsible for coordinating the movement of goods, vehicles, or personnel to ensure efficient operations within a company. They typically manage schedules, communicate with drivers or staff, track shipments or deliveries, and resolve issues that arise during transit. Their role is crucial in industries like logistics, transportation, and warehousing, where timely and accurate dispatch is essential. Dispatch Associates use technology and strong organizational skills to keep operations running smoothly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a dispatch associ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Dispatch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with dispatch software, GPS tracking systems, and basic office applications is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and multitasking abilities help you manage fast-paced environments and coordinate effectively with drivers and clients. These skills ensure timely and accurate dispatching, efficient operations, and high customer satisfaction.

What are some common challenges dispatch associates face, and how can they overcome them?

Dispatch Associates often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of requests, adapting to last-minute schedule changes, and coordinating effectively with drivers and warehouse teams. Staying organized, using digital dispatching tools, and maintaining clear communication channels are key strategies for success. Proactively anticipating potential issues and keeping a calm, solution-oriented mindset can help Dispatch Associates manage stress and ensure timely deliveries.

What is the difference between Dispatch Associate v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ectDispatch AssociateWarehouse Associate
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ma, basic computer skills, familiarity with dispatch softwareHigh school diploma, physical ability, forklift certification (optional)
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, dispatch centers, logistics operationsWarehouse, storage facilities, distribution centers
Employer & Industry UsageLogistics companies, delivery services, transportation firmsWarehousing, retail distribution, manufacturing
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

The Dispatch Associate primarily manages communication and coordination of deliveries, often working in an office environment with dispatch software. In contrast, the Warehouse Associate handles physical tasks like inventory management and order fulfillment within a warehouse setting. While both roles support logistics operations, their daily responsibilities and work environments differ significantly.

How to start a dispatch associate with no experience?

To start as a dispatch associate with no experience, focus on developing strong organizational and communication skills, and familiarize yourself with transportation management software. Entry-level roles often provide on-the-job training, so demonstrating reliability and a willingness to learn can help you secure a position.

Is it hard to get hired as a dispatch associate?

Getting hired as a dispatch associate typically requires good communication skills, organization, and sometimes prior experience with logistics or transportation software. The hiring process can vary by employer but often involves interviews and background checks; some roles may also require a valid driver's license or certification. Overall, the difficulty depends on the job market and individual qualifications, but entry-level positions are generally accessible to those with relevant skills and a clean background.

Job Overview

The Seasonal Support Associate primary objective is to drive sales and profit through efficient inbound/outbound receipt processing and excellent stockroom standards. This includes offloading, sorting, unpacking and prepping new receipts.

Seasonal associates are eligible to receive a bonus incentive upon completion of their seasonal assignment, colleague discounts and the opportunity to be a part of an iconic brand during the most exciting time of the year. 

Essential Functions

  • Flexibility to work schedules based on business needs and inbound truck schedule.
  • Support and administer receipt and dispatch of merchandise and supplies according to company standards.
  • Receive and record trailer delivery.
  • Offload, sort and prepare merchandise for floor ready processing.
  • Process merchandise ensuring items are floor ready, tagged, and ticketed.
  • Protects Company assets, adhering to all operational procedures including: Access Control, Merchandise Protection, Risk Management, Receiving & Processing and Fine Jewelry.
  • Maximize stockroom space and maintain the highest level of organization and efficiency.
  • Place new merchandise on selling floor using floor maps and visual execution standards.
  • Use appropriate guidance to ensure selling floor is set to company guidelines and expectations.
  • Confirm correct customer facing signing is complete.
  • Complete price changes, damages/salvages, job out/RTV.
  • Assist in maintaining a clean, neat and organized back office receiving and stockroom space.
  • Must adhere to all company standards as provided in the Employee Handbook.
  • Maintains a clean and safe work environment.
  • Regular dependable attendance and punctuality.
  • Supports team members, understanding how teamwork plays an important role in providing a positive customer experience.

Qualifications

  • Candidates with a High School Diploma or equivalent are encouraged to apply
  • No experience required
  • Excellent communication skills. Professional demeanor.
  • Basic math skills such as add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division
  • Highly organized and ability to adapt quickly to changing priorities
  • Flexible with scheduling and available to work retail hours, which may include day, evening, weekends and/or holidays based on department/store/company needs

Physical Requirements

  • Requires periods of walking, standing, communicating, reaching, crouching and climbing ladders 
  • Frequent use of computers and other technology, necessary to perform job functions, including handheld equipment, cash register and ability to process register transactions 
  • Frequently lift/move up to 25lbs.
